Though the panel was titled “GMO Labeling: The Changing Political Landscape,” the debate was not about labeling so much as it was the issue of mandatory labeling. Dr. Enright made clear that she supports the right of companies to opt into labeling privately; as you’ve no doubt heard, starting in 2018, Whole Foods will require all products with GMO ingredients that are sold in their stores to be labeled. Dr. Enright made clear that she thinks this is the company’s prerogative, and that she also supports organizations like the non-GMO project. The issue at hand was whether or not all food manufacturers should be required by law to label GMO products–the same issue that was at stake in the defeated Prop 37 bill in California this fall.

As the debate got started, Dr. Enright articulated BIO’s major opposition to mandatory labeling. It is this: in this country, mandatory labeling is typically reserved for foods (or products) that have a proven health risk. We’re told that milk is pasteurized because unpasteurized milk contains more microorganisms than raw milk and is, according to the CDC, 150 times more likely to cause foodborne illness than unpasteurized milk. We see labels on Sweet N’ Low because saccharin has been shown, in concert with cyclamate, to cause bladder cancer in laboratory rats (though its safety for humans is the subject of some debate). Trans fats are now being labeled because of their implication in heart disease. When a food is labeled by law, she argued, it is because it poses a known hazard. Since there is no hard evidence that genetically engineered foods pose a health threat–and a lot of peer-reviewed evidence to suggest that they are safe–Dr. Enright’s position is that mandatory labeling of GMO’s will frighten and alienate consumers and possibly interrupt the food chain needlessly.

Mr. Faber countered this argument by saying that health risks are actually not the only grounds for mandatory labeling. The Food, Drug, and Cosmetic (FD&C) Act of 1938 holds that products cannot be labeled deceptively; they cannot be labeled as one thing and really be another. Mr. Faber’s argument is that consumers today who purchase “corn” expect it to be the corn they know and recognize from their whole lifetimes; they do not expect it to be corn that produces a protein that kills insects, a foodstuff that has entered our food chain only within the last twenty years. Consumers don’t expect salmon to actually be salmon that grows twice as fast as non-GMO salmon. Genetically modified foods should be labeled, he alleges, because what they really are and what consumers believe them to be are two different things.

Of course, the debate did ultimately delve into health, environment, and the broader virtues (or lack thereof) of GMO crops. Dr. Enright’s principle argument in favor of GMOs is that they have the capacity to resist harsh weather and other conditions that might jeopardize crops. For this reason, they may be what is necessary to feed the world’s ever growing population. Organic and small scale farming, for all of its virtues and appeal, may not be powerful enough to fight off malnutrition and starvation on other continents. Is the anti-GMO position a luxury that only financially secure people in first world countries can afford? Is it privileged?

No direct counter to this position was offered, but Mr. Faber raised another difficult question in response: what about Roundup resistant “superweeds,” which are growing in response to foods that have been engineered to be resistant to roundup? Is there an environmental cost to GMOs that might outweigh their potential benefits?

Beneath all of this, too, was an argument about how genetic engineering fits into the broader scheme of human agriculture. Dr. Enright pointed out that genetic modification is simply the latest step in a process that began with Mendel’s crossing of pea plants; human beings have always created “novel organisms” through the agricultural process, and in fact GMO production is more carefully monitored than other methods, like chemical sprays, have been. Mr. Faber argued that, because GMO foods are relatively recent (they have been a major part of our food supply for twenty years or so), and because so little evidence exists about their longterm impact, they are and should be regarded as new entities, even if food production is essentially timeless.

Sifting through the evidence we have about GMOs is no easy task. The majority of peer-reviewed evidence out there points to the safety of GMOs, but there have also been some studies that call potential hazards into question. (Marion Nestle lead me to this report, which is illuminating; the now famous French study led by Gilles-Eric Seralini, which linked GMOs to tumor development in rats, has been widely critiqued for its complications and incomplete data, and it does not seem to me to be a reliable resource.) On both sides of the debate, it is hard to find impartial research. Many studies supporting the safety of GMO foods have been funded by those who are developing them, which makes consumers understandably hesitant. On the flip side, a lot of the criticisms of GMO foods are from people who are expressly opposed to them, and some are not rooted in hard science or experimental data.

As someone who is considering a career in gastroenterology, I’m curious about the alleged possibility of a connection between GMO foods and intestinal hyperpermeability, or leaky gut syndrome. Leaky gut syndrome results when tight junctions, which help to maintain a barrier in the gut, are disrupted, and unwanted particles or proteins pass into the bloodstream. It is a somewhat new and only partially understood phenomenon (indeed, it is only just now being recognized within the medical community), but it appears to be presenting more frequently. A host of issues could be to blame for it (including any of the many suboptimal foods that are common in the standard American diet), but the fact that the condition has been on the rise since GMOs were introduced into our food supply is a hot topic in GI health circles. We don’t have research to substantiate such a claim, and we may find that leaky gut has nothing to do with GMOs at all. But the question is, until we have more longterm evidence of GMO safety, is the fact that there might be a connection enough to make us steer clear?

  11. Thanks so much Gena for this very informative post! As a registered dietitian, I am concerned about how the debate seemed to dismiss the potential health hazards of GMOs simply because there is no hard evidence to date that suggests they are harmful.
    It seems that all too often health and nutrition authorities take the stance that engineered foods or artificial foods created in a laboratory are safe until proven otherwise. Unfortunately in the past, this has led to many premature recommendations and policies that have had unintended health consequences.

    I thought it was interesting that one of the speakers used trans fat as an example of mandatory labeling due to their implication in heart disease. It’s important to remember trans fats were once incorporated into many products (margarines etc) with the intention of REDUCING heart disease. When I was a nutrition student in college just 10 years ago, nutrition professionals (PhDs and RDs) were still encouraging patients to consume products containing trans fats as a “healthier” replacement for the saturated fat in their diets. It wasn’t until later that a significant amount of research revealed that trans fats were even more harmful than traditional foods high in saturated fat. This is one example where premature recommendations did more harm than good. There are numerous examples of this in nutrition, such as the harm associated with certain fat soluble vitamins when taken as a pill versus a whole food.

    I am a western trained nutritionist and was taught in school to focus on hard evidence and peer reviewed research. In my experience, many traditional nutrition programs largely frown upon the holistic communities. However, in my ten years of experience in the field of nutrition (some of it directly involved with clinical research), I have been humbled at how often the holistic community turns out to be correct. I am now much more critical and skeptical of published research and its source of funding than I was as a dietetic student.

    I think there is a great need for the traditional health and nutrition communities to be more open minded and less dismissive on a number of issues including the safety concerns of GMOs. There is some evidence that GMOs may be linked to allergies, some cancers and leaky gut as you discussed. The long-term health effects of GMOs are largely unknown and they may include a number of side effects we are not aware of yet. In addition, as you mentioned, much of the research that indicates GMOs are safe were funded by the companies that developed them. Time will certainly tell. I think in the meantime consumers should have the right to know what they are eating and make their own decisions about whether they feel it is safe to consume genetically modified foods.

  14. On a personal level, I have a visceral fascination with genetic engineering. As a teenager, I briefly considered career of a GM researcher, inspired by the idea of making a better world and solving hunger problems, etc. And I am glad to see that other people are doing this work.

    To sum up the positions I currently hold:

    1. I fully share the unease about large corporations, monopolies, and Monsanto. However, here’s a point I did not realize before: given the current costs of ensuring GMO safety, decades of testing, etc., *nobody else can afford to develop GM technologies*. Effectively, a consequence of raising the bar on health and safety puts up a cost barrier that excludes smaller sized competition.

    2. Regarding health, the so-called “natural selection” has changed a great deal in the 20th century. We are worried about GMO, that changes several genes in a controlled fashion.

    Yet we are not worried and are not even talking about labelling products produced through chemical mutagenesis, i.e. exposing plants to radiation or chemical mutagens to increase the rate of mutation, hoping to increase useful traits. Check out the Wikipedia article on “mutation breeding”! None of them are labelled because they are more “natural”, than GMO. We are not researching ongoing natural mutations in existing crops either.

    Basically, we are concerned about a much safer and controlled technology while completely ignoring ones that are, by the same logic, much less safe. Furthermore, we know for sure that many old-fashioned crops are very dangerous and can kill people. Peanuts and other nuts? Potatoes and solanine? But they are all okay. So we are applying totally different rules to GMO plants than to all others – even though GMO mutations are controlled while all other mutations are not. As the result, for me, concern about GMO and health is increasingly looking like a witch-hunt, an emotional panic against technology, than true investigation of health issues.
